diff options
author | viettrungluu@chromium.org <viettrungluu@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2010-08-05 21:53:13 +0000 |
---|---|---|
committer | viettrungluu@chromium.org <viettrungluu@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2010-08-05 21:53:13 +0000 |
commit | c078968a5fcdbad7c12ab954f60667a78a737582 (patch) | |
tree | 3f9bb4b8221f9bb030ff25f0035ea757b3eb5a42 /chrome/browser/automation | |
parent | cba81a7d6830877c3deaab58c5db70438aecfab7 (diff) | |
download | chromium_src-c078968a5fcdbad7c12ab954f60667a78a737582.zip chromium_src-c078968a5fcdbad7c12ab954f60667a78a737582.tar.gz chromium_src-c078968a5fcdbad7c12ab954f60667a78a737582.tar.bz2 |
Remove obviously unneeded forward declarations in chrome/browser/[abef]*/*.h.
BUG=none
TEST=builds
Review URL: http://codereview.chromium.org/3027041
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@55136 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/browser/automation')
-rw-r--r-- | chrome/browser/automation/automation_provider.h | 5 | ||||
-rw-r--r-- | chrome/browser/automation/automation_provider_json.h | 9 | ||||
-rw-r--r-- | chrome/browser/automation/extension_port_container.h | 1 |
3 files changed, 6 insertions, 9 deletions
diff --git a/chrome/browser/automation/automation_provider.h b/chrome/browser/automation/automation_provider.h index fd3d2f5..94a697c 100644 --- a/chrome/browser/automation/automation_provider.h +++ b/chrome/browser/automation/automation_provider.h @@ -57,17 +57,12 @@ class LoginHandler; class MetricEventDurationObserver; class InitialLoadObserver; class NavigationControllerRestoredObserver; -class TranslateInfoBarDelegate; struct AutocompleteMatchData; namespace gfx { class Point; } -namespace webkit_glue { -struct PasswordForm; -} - class AutomationProvider : public base::RefCounted<AutomationProvider>, public IPC::Channel::Listener, public IPC::Message::Sender { diff --git a/chrome/browser/automation/automation_provider_json.h b/chrome/browser/automation/automation_provider_json.h index 00859fb..692af80 100644 --- a/chrome/browser/automation/automation_provider_json.h +++ b/chrome/browser/automation/automation_provider_json.h @@ -10,10 +10,14 @@ #include <string> -#include "base/values.h" -#include "ipc/ipc_message.h" #include "chrome/browser/automation/automation_provider.h" +class Value; + +namespace IPC { +class Message; +} + // Helper to ensure we always send a reply message for JSON automation requests. class AutomationJSONReply { public: @@ -38,4 +42,3 @@ class AutomationJSONReply { }; #endif // CHROME_BROWSER_AUTOMATION_AUTOMATION_PROVIDER_JSON_H_ - diff --git a/chrome/browser/automation/extension_port_container.h b/chrome/browser/automation/extension_port_container.h index 745bff1..1325303 100644 --- a/chrome/browser/automation/extension_port_container.h +++ b/chrome/browser/automation/extension_port_container.h @@ -16,7 +16,6 @@ class AutomationProvider; class ExtensionMessageService; class GURL; class ListValue; -class MessageLoop; class RenderViewHost; // This class represents an external port to an extension, opened |